INDEX
如何使用COUNTIF统计“~以上~未满”的数量?
在Excel中,当需要根据特定条件统计数量时,可以使用COUNTIF函数。然而,当涉及“~以上~未满”范围的统计时,需要采取一些技巧。本文将介绍如何使用COUNTIF函数统计特定范围内的数量。
COUNTIF函数的基本用法
COUNTIF函数用于统计指定范围内符合条件的单元格数量。基本语法如下:
=COUNTIF(范围, 条件)
但是,当需要统计“~以上~未满”这样的范围时,应该使用COUNTIFS函数。
示例:使用COUNTIFS统计“~以上~未满”的范围
例如,统计单元格范围A1:A5中,值在“50以上100未满”范围内的数量,可以使用以下公式:
A | B | |
---|---|---|
1 | 45 | |
2 | 55 | |
3 | 60 | |
4 | 80 | |
5 | 100 | =COUNTIFS(A1:A5, “>=50”, A1:A5, “<100”) |
在此表格中,符合“50以上100未满”条件的值为55、60和80。
函数
=COUNTIFS(A1:A5, “>=50”, A1:A5, “<100”)
步骤
- 在单元格A1到A5中输入数字。
- 在用于显示统计结果的单元格(如B5)中,输入以下公式:=COUNTIFS(A1:A5, “>=50”, A1:A5, “<100”)
- 按下回车键,符合条件的单元格数量将显示在B5中。
结果
在此示例中,符合“50以上100未满”条件的单元格有3个(分别为A2、A3和A4),因此B5显示“3”。
不使用COUNTIFS的替代方法
可以通过以下公式实现同样的统计:
=SUM((A1:A5>=50)*(A1:A5<100))
但由于公式较复杂,不推荐使用。
扩展应用:使用COUNTIFS统计多个条件
COUNTIFS函数允许对两个或更多范围和条件进行组合统计,从而实现更加灵活的计数。例如,可以同时统计“10以上50未满”和“80以上100未满”这样的不同范围。
总结
COUNTIF函数适用于单一条件的统计,而对于多个条件(如“~以上~未满”)的统计,建议使用COUNTIFS函数。通过使用“>=”和“<”等条件,可以轻松统计特定范围内的数量。